Transaction d50938aefba2a18c12854609849b7b486e5d52d0e2e1c99f4b00fc842b2405be

11 Input
2 Outputs
  • d50938aefba2a18c12854609849b7b486e5d52d0e2e1c99f4b00fc842b2405be:0
  • value  146243872
    address  bc1q8x3zzmaplvx0zkjau0j2te5fp8ggz2zftsfp4d
  • d50938aefba2a18c12854609849b7b486e5d52d0e2e1c99f4b00fc842b2405be:1
  • value  10853754097
    address  1GpsQWLA1Myq1ovKS5eTqWW1QMpWLT3jYL